Solomon Johnson Jr.1

M, b. circa 1780, d. December 1802
Solomon Johnson Jr.|b. c 1780\nd. Dec 1802|p700.htm#i33522|Solomon Johnson Sr.|b. c 1735\nd. 1794|p124.htm#i5332|Rachel Byrd|b. c 1733|p124.htm#i5331|||||||Nathaniel Byrd Sr.|b. c 1702\nd. 29 Feb 1780|p123.htm#i5298|Cathern (-----)|b. c 1702|p123.htm#i5303|
     Solomon was born circa 1780 at Accomack Co, VA. He was the son of Solomon Johnson Sr. and Rachel Byrd. Solomon was named in his father's will on 30 June 1790 at Accomack Co, VA. He was under age at this time..2 He made a will on 26 November 1802 at Accomack Co, VA. Brother Zadock Johnson and Elijah Shay executors. To cousin Tabitha Northam all my bonds & notes, a place to live in my dwelling house, fire wood to support her during her life, 1 bay horse, 6 windsor chairs, bed & furniture. To Richard Bloxom, my friend, the privilege of getting 10 thousand fence rails on my land adjoining the land's of James Cropper. To brother Zadock Johnson, the land whereon I live estimated to be 100 acres with all appurtenances. To brother Zadock Johnson 46 acres of land adjoining Bennett Mason, James Duncan and the heirs of Griffin Kelly, dec'd. All my estate not given to brother Zadock Johnson. Witnesses Elijah Shay, George Christopher & John Northam..3 Solomon died in December 1802 at Accomack Co, VA.3 Solomon's will was probated on 27 December 1802 at Accomack Co, VA.3

Zadock Johnson1

M, b. circa 1782, d. 1833
Zadock Johnson|b. c 1782\nd. 1833|p700.htm#i33523|Solomon Johnson Sr.|b. c 1735\nd. 1794|p124.htm#i5332|Rachel Byrd|b. c 1733|p124.htm#i5331|||||||Nathaniel Byrd Sr.|b. c 1702\nd. 29 Feb 1780|p123.htm#i5298|Cathern (-----)|b. c 1702|p123.htm#i5303|
     Zadock was born circa 1782 at Accomack Co, VA. He was the son of Solomon Johnson Sr. and Rachel Byrd. Zadock was named in his father's will on 30 June 1790 at Accomack Co, VA. He was underage at this time..2 Zadock was named in his brother's will on 26 November 1802 at Accomack Co, VA. His brother Solomon Johnson left him the land whereon I live estimated to be 100 acres with all appurtenances and 46 acres of land adjoining Bennett Mason, James Duncan and the heirs of Griffin Kelly, dec'd..3 He made a will on 31 January 1817 at Accomack Co, VA. To my cousin William Northam Senr. my negro named Daniel until he arrives to the age of 21, then he to be free. To negro man Reed at my decease his freedom. To my cousin Talitha Northam one negro boy Perry and a gegro girl named Leah until they arrive to the age of 21 and then I give them their freedom. To my cousin Rachel Northam a certain parcel of land that my father Solomon Johnson bought of Wm. H. Beavans containing 50 acres. To cousin Talitha Northam the plantation whereon I now live containing 150 acres and my water grist mill and saw mill. To cousin Talitha Northam 122 acres of land that is called Gail land. To cousin Talitha Northam all the remained of my estate. Cousin Talitha Northam to be executrix. Wit: Southy Northam, George Northam and Obadiah Riggin..4 Zadock died in 1833 at Accomack Co, VA.4 Zadock's will was probated on 29 July 1833 at Accomack Co, VA. James Northam and Henry Fletcher securities for Talitha Northam..4

Henry P. Lilliston1

M, b. 1814, d. 6 July 1866
Henry P. Lilliston|b. 1814\nd. 6 Jul 1866|p700.htm#i33528|John S. Lilliston|b. c 1792\nd. Apr 1855|p971.htm#i42201||||||||||||||||
     Henry was born in 1814 at Accomack Co, VA.2 He was the son of John S. Lilliston. He married Mary A. Finney on 2 August 1841 at Accomack Co, VA. George Hickman was the security on the M.L.B. of Henry P. Lilliston and Mary A. Finney of Sarah S..3 Henry was listed as a head of household in the census of in 1850 at Accomack Parish, Acc Co, VA. He was shown as Henry P. Lilliston the head of HH#14, a 36 year old carpenter with real estate valued at $1,600. Listed with him were Mary A. Lilliston, age 24; Alfred J. Lilliston, age 5; Laura Lilliston, age 4/12; Joseph Moore, a 19 year old apprentice; and Parker Waters, a 18 year old black laborer..4 He married Elizabeth S. Powell on 30 June 1853 at Accomack Co, VA. He was shown as Henry P. Lilliston, widower, and she was shown as Elizabeth Powell of Seth..3 Henry died on 6 July 1866.2 His body was interred at Edgehill Cem, Accomac, Acc Co, VA.2
